Halifax Airport Shuttle – Terms of Service

Welcome! You’re on your way to booking your door-to-door Halifax Airport Shuttle. Please read these terms to ensure a smooth experience.

Our shared shuttle typically includes 2–5 passengers travelling to or from flights with similar schedules. We always aim for minimal waiting, but shared shuttle users should expect up to 20 minutes of wait time while we pair passengers. Keep in mind that you may be the one arriving later, giving you little to no wait time yourself. Shared shuttles operate with the group in mind—if you prefer a direct, private experience with no waiting, please choose our Private Ride service.

All booking times must be entered using the 24-hour clock format. We follow the same standard as airports and do not use AM/PM.

Please note that excessive or oversized luggage may require booking a private vehicle. The included checked luggage limit per group is as follows:
1 passenger – 2 bags
2 passengers – 4 bags
3 passengers – 5 bags
4 passengers – 6 bags
5 passengers – 7 bags
6 passengers – 8 bags

All animals, including service animals, must be declared at the time of booking.

Children in Nova Scotia must travel in the appropriate safety seats as required by law.
Under one year old or under 10 kg must use a rear-facing seat.
Up to 18 kg (40 lb) requires a forward-facing seat.
A booster seat is required until the child reaches 145 cm (4’9”) or nine years of age.
Child seats may be available for rent; please inquire in advance.

Customers with accessibility needs may require a private vehicle, depending on the level of accommodation required.

We strive to keep our vehicles scent-free. Please avoid using strong fragrances before your ride.

Multiple addresses are included in the group booking price, provided they fall within our coverage area and make logistical sense. For example, a three-person booking cannot include drop-offs in Clayton Park, Dartmouth, and Downtown Halifax without an additional surcharge.

We assign drivers and finalize schedules approximately 12 hours before service. Last-minute shuttle requests must fit into the existing schedule, which may result in longer wait times or availability of only a private ride.
